Lubricating equipment for elevator steel wire rope parts
Technical Field
The invention relates to the technical field of elevators, in particular to a lubricating device for steel wire rope parts of an elevator.
Background
The traction steel wire rope of the elevator is an important component, and the maintenance of the steel wire rope plays an important role in normal and safe operation of the elevator, so that the maintenance of the steel wire rope is an important link of elevator maintenance at ordinary times.
At present, partial lubricating equipment for elevator steel wire rope parts cannot be disassembled and oiled, and can only be lubricated through manual oiling, but during manual treatment, accidents easily occur during operation, certain damage is caused, oiling is insufficient, and subsequent abrasion of the steel wire rope and the rope wheel and the rusting condition of the steel wire rope are caused.

Referring to fig. 1-5, the present invention provides a technical solution: a lubricating device for elevator steel wire rope parts comprises an elevator working box 1, a steel wire rope 10 and a lubricating mechanism 16 are arranged inside the elevator working box 1, an oil tank 2 is welded and installed at the top of the elevator working box 1, a heating plate 5 is welded and installed at the top of the inner side of the oil tank 2, an input pipeline 3 is arranged on one side of the elevator working box 1, the other end of the input pipeline 3 extends into the oil tank 2, an L-shaped oil outlet pipe 6 is welded and installed at the bottom of the oil tank 2, the L-shaped oil outlet pipe 6 is communicated with the inside of the oil tank 2, a filter box 7 is welded and installed at the other side of the elevator working box 1, the other end of the L-shaped oil outlet pipe 6 penetrates through the elevator working box 1 and extends into the filter box 7, and oil bodies needing to be lubricated can be stored through the matching use of the oil tank 2, the input pipeline 3, a fixing ring 4, the steel wire rope 10 can be conveniently lubricated and oiled at any time, the steel wire rope 10 can be conveniently maintained, the steel wire rope 10 can ensure the stability of the speed of an elevator in the running process, the situations that oil is gradually reduced and dirt such as dust, scraps and the like is adhered to the surface of the steel wire rope due to long-time use of the steel wire rope 10 to cause abrasion of the steel wire rope and a rope wheel and rusting of the steel wire rope are avoided, a bidirectional hydraulic rod 11 is welded and installed at the top of the inner side of an elevator working box 1, a mounting box 12 is welded and installed at one end of the bidirectional hydraulic rod 11, brushes 15 are welded and installed at two sides of the mounting box 12 and communicated with each other, a liquid outlet hose 14 is welded and installed at the bottom of an oil tank 2, the liquid outlet hose 14 is communicated with the inside of the oil tank 2, the other end of the liquid, pour into a certain amount of lubricating oil to oil tank 2 through input pipeline 3, open the valve on the play liquid hose 14, lubricating oil gets into the mounting box 12 through going out liquid hose 14 in, through the processing of oiling of brush 15 to the wire rope 10 that is located the car top, along with the rising and the decline of car, drive wire rope 10 longitudinal motion, contact and the processing of oiling round trip with brush 15, need not artifical manual oiling, avoid appearing unexpected condition, can also alleviate intensity of labour, the processing of oiling in succession, make wire rope oil comparatively abundant, prolong its life.
The lubricating mechanism 16 comprises a motor 1601, a first connecting rod 1602, a second connecting rod 1603, an arched rod 1604, an installation sleeve 1605, a hinge rod 1606, an extrusion oil tank 1607, an extrusion block 1608, a sponge brush 1609, an installation rod 1610, an installation arched plate 1611, a fixed brush 1612, fan blades 1613, a clamping groove 1614, a third connecting rod 1615 and a lantern ring 1616, wherein the motor 1601 is welded and installed on the inner wall of one side of the elevator working box 1, the first connecting rod 1602 is welded and installed on an output shaft of the motor 1601 through a coupler, the second connecting rod 1603 is rotatably installed on the inner wall of the other side of the elevator working box 1, the arched rods 1604 are welded and installed on the outer walls of the first connecting rod 1602 and the second connecting rod 1603, the third connecting rod 1615 is welded and installed on the adjacent side walls of the two groups of arched rods 1604, the two groups of installation rods 1610 are welded and installed on the inner wall of the front side of the elevator working box 1, the extrusion oil tank, the outer wall of the installation sleeve 1605 is hinged with a hinge rod 1606, the inside of the extrusion oil tank 1607 is slidably provided with an extrusion block 1608, the other end of the hinge rod 1606 extends into the extrusion oil tank 1607 and is hinged with the rear side of the extrusion block 1608, the inside of the extrusion oil tank 1607 is provided with a sponge brush 1609, the outside of the third connecting rod 1615 is rotatably provided with a lantern ring 1616, the outer wall of the lantern ring 1616 is welded with an installation arched plate 1611, the front side of the installation arched plate 1611 is provided with a clamping groove 1614, the clamping groove 1614 is internally clamped with a fixed brush 1612, one side of the elevator working box 1 is welded with a fixed ring 4, the fixed ring 4 wraps the input pipeline 3 and plays a role in fixation, the extrusion oil tank 1607 is located at the rear side of the sponge brush 1609 and is not fixed, the top and the bottom of the extrusion oil tank 1607 are both provided with openings attached to the steel wire rope 10, one side of the extrusion oil tank 1607 is welded, one end of the oil inlet pipe is in threaded connection with a knob cover, the knob cover can be disassembled, lubricating oil enters the oil tank 2 through the oil inlet pipe after being disassembled, the oil inlet pipe is closed after being assembled, the other end of the bidirectional hydraulic rod 11 extends into the oil tank 2 and is welded with a stirring rod 19 to play a role in stirring, an installation ring 13 is welded and installed on the outer wall of the bidirectional hydraulic rod 11, the liquid outlet hose 14 is wrapped in the installation ring 13 to play a role in fixed protection, a collection box 17 is arranged at the bottom inside the elevator working tank 1, a placement groove is formed in the bottom of the collection box 17, an electromagnet 18 is welded and installed in the placement groove, the bottom of the electromagnet 18 is attracted with the bottom inside the elevator working tank 1 to facilitate assembly and disassembly and play a role in collection, a filter layer 8 is arranged inside the filter tank 7 to play a role in filtering, and a liquid outlet pipe 9 is welded, the liquid outlet pipe 9 is communicated with the inside of the filter box 7, the liquid outlet pipe 9 is positioned below the filter layer 8, the outer wall of the extrusion oil tank 1607 is in contact with and not fixed with the first connecting rod 1602, the second connecting rod 1603 and the third connecting rod 1615, the outer wall of the first connecting rod 1602 is welded with the fan blade 1613, the fan blade 1613 is arranged to carry out heat dissipation treatment on the motor 1601, the service life of the motor 1601 is prolonged, the motor 1601 is controlled to be started to drive the first connecting rod 1602 to rotate, the first connecting rod 1602 drives the mounting sleeve 1605 to rotate, the hinge rod 1606 is driven to push forwards through the matching use of the mounting sleeve 1605 and the hinge rod 1606 to drive the oil body to move forwards and to be in contact with the sponge brush 1609, so that the steel wire rope 10 positioned in the extrusion oil tank 1607 can be in contact with the oil body and fully absorb the oil body, the lubricating quality is improved, compared with manual work, the invention has uniform, the setting dismantled of fixed brush 1612, when following car longitudinal movement, can scrub the car outer wall, the dust is collected through collecting box 17, the clearance of being convenient for.
The working principle is as follows: when the elevator normally operates, a certain amount of lubricating oil is poured into the oil tank 2 through the input pipeline 3, a valve on the liquid outlet hose 14 is opened, the lubricating oil enters the installation box 12 through the liquid outlet hose 14, the steel wire rope 10 above the car is oiled through the brush 15, the steel wire rope 10 is driven to move longitudinally along with the ascending and descending of the car, the steel wire rope is contacted with the brush 15 back and forth and oiled, the control motor 1601 is started, the first connecting rod 1602 is driven to rotate, the first connecting rod 1602 drives the installation sleeve 1605 to rotate, the hinge rod 1606 is driven to push forwards through the matching of the installation sleeve 1605 and the hinge rod 1606, the oil body is driven to move forwards and is contacted with the sponge brush 1609, and the steel wire rope 10 in the extrusion oil tank 1607 can be contacted with the oil body and can be.
